Job Purpose We develop and manage the design and engineering for pipeline projects within the New England North distribution territory. We are a high-performing team made up of civil and mechanical engineers of all skill and experience levels and are positioned under the supervision and mentorship of Professional Engineers. Key Accountabilities Develop and coordinate designs for natural gas engineering projects to improve and grow our distribution system. Assess project scopes to identify local requirements and risks prior to design to ensure a complete, high quality and safe project outcome. Manage multiple projects and prioritize work collaboratively with internal and external stakeholders. Design and construction drawings using AutoCAD in accordance with company and industry standards. Manage external engineering design firms and ensure their designs are completed in accordance with company and industry standards. Review construction standard operating procedures to ensure they are completed in accordance with company and industry standards. Qualifications ABET-accredited B.S. Degree in Civil or Mechanical Engineering required. 1+ years in a civil or mechanical engineering role preferred. Proficiency using the Microsoft Office Suite preferred. Proficiency in AutoCAD or similar design products preferred. Experience using ArcGIS software preferred. EIT or ability to obtain within one year required. Valid driver's license required.
